How To Choose The Best Bean Bag Sofa

Not all bean bag sofas are built alike. The most common mistake is picking one based on size alone without checking how the fill behaves after weeks of daily use. Here are the three specs that separate a long-term lounger from a temporary novelty.

Fill Material: The Structural Backbone

The fill is the single biggest factor in long-term satisfaction. Shredded foam offers a good balance of softness and shape retention, but low-density foam compresses permanently within months. Memory foam cores deliver superior rebound — they spring back after each use and resist flattening even under heavier loads. Kapok or polyester fiber fills are the lightest and softest but degrade fastest. Look for high-density shredded foam (above 30D) or a solid memory foam block for furniture-grade durability.

Fabric Cover: Where Comfort Meets Cleanability

Faux fur and teddy velvet feel plush and warm, making them ideal for cooler rooms, but they trap dust and pet hair. Corded plush and chenille are more breathable and easier to spot-clean. Removable, machine-washable covers are a huge advantage — without them, the entire unit must be cleaned as a whole, which is impractical for most households. Check whether the cover zipper allows easy removal without tearing the fabric.

Shape and Back Support

Shell-shaped designs with scalloped backrests offer structured lumbar support and prevent slouching. Fireside-style chairs with taller, tufted backs support the neck and shoulders, making them better for reading or watching TV. Boneless, amorphous sacks sacrifice support for sprawl — they’re great for napping but poor for sitting upright. If you plan to use the sofa for more than 30 minutes at a time, choose a design with a defined back and arm support.

FAQ

How long does a bean bag sofa take to fully expand after unboxing?
Most bean bag sofas require 48 to 72 hours to reach full size after being removed from vacuum packaging. Shredded foam and memory foam models rebound faster than kapok or polyester fiber fills. Gently patting the bag during expansion helps distribute the fill evenly and reduces lumpiness.
Can I use a bean bag sofa outdoors?
Most bean bag sofas are rated for indoor use only. The fill materials — shredded foam, memory foam, or kapok — degrade quickly in direct sunlight and moisture. A few models with outdoor-rated fabric and quick-dry foam exist, but standard units should stay in covered, dry spaces.
How do I clean a bean bag sofa that does not have a removable cover?
Spot cleaning with a mild detergent and a damp cloth is the safest method for non-removable covers. Avoid soaking the fabric, as moisture can wick into the foam fill and cause mold or odor. For deep cleaning, professional upholstery cleaning is recommended — never submerge the entire unit in water.
